6. 8 Input 128 is an internal default for the disconnect status Please see Network recommendations for use of RS 422 data routers for further information 7 1 4 Timeout The Crosspoint Status Request message has a timeout which means that you need to wait 1 second in between request messages 7 2 Basic principles Any message on any level address which conforms to the standard arriving at either the MIDI or the RS232 port will be re sent on both MIDI and RS232 The only exceptions are a A matrix which recognizes its address will not re transmit the message if the crosspoint is already set b A matrix which recognizes its address will not re transmit the message if the output number or input number exceeds its size c A unit matrix or panel will not re transmit a message arriving at the MIDI if it was re transmitted a short while ago typically 0 5 sec This is done by grabbing a message storing it for the timeout period and comparing it with new messages After the timeout period the unit will grab a new message for compare This is done to remove unwanted read unknown messages from the MIDI ring d A message arriving at the RS232 will always be re transmitted unless it is a matrix and one of the cases a or b is fulfilled 7 2 1 Example A single unit with no MIDI connected Messages sent to the RS232 of a single unit will be returned once no matter what address or input output number the message has unless it is a matrix whi

8. ch recognizes one of the conditions a or b above 7 2 2 Example Several units connected by MIDI Messages sent to the RS232 of a single unit will be returned once no matter what address or input output number the message has unless it is a matrix which recognizes one of the conditions a or b above Technical specifications are subject to be changed without notice CENA Routing Switcher Series LE Revision 2 13 If none of the cases a or b is fulfilled the message will also be transmitted on the MIDI Then if any unit on the MIDI ring recognizes any of the cases a b or c the message will stop at that point This means that the message will only be returned once on the RS232 However if none of the units on the MIDI ring recognizes any of the cases a to c the message will return to the originator the unit which received the message on RS232 This unit will re transmit the message once more on both MIDI and RS232 The message is therefore returned a second time on RS232 This time one of the cases a or c is sure to be identified by one of the units on the MIDI ring and the message is removed There is however one more special case If several messages for unused addresses are transmitted with only little delay one might experience that some messages are returned several times as the store compare remove function in case c can only handle a single message at the time We therefore recommend that the user avoid sending messages to

14. s for video in and outputs All video inputs are terminated with 75 ohms 7 Control and connection of Network systems interface protocol 7 1 Important notes regarding the Network Control Protocol 7 1 1 Binary Code The strings shown on the next pages are in binary coded format Please be aware of the fact that any terminal program you may use to control a Network unit from a PC must be able to generate hexadecimal characters ASCII characters will not be accepted 7 1 2 Acknowledge Echo A matrix will reply on a crosspoint set command with an ECHO In the case where a crosspoint is already set no ECHO will be sent If the matrix is part of a MIDI system two types of reply will be sent Immediately after receiving the crosspoint set command the ECHO will be sent The matrix will then wait for the command to pass the MIDI bus system After receiving the command from the MIDI bus system the matrix will send the command as an ACKNOWLEDGE 7 1 3 RS 422 Matrixes RS 422 Data Routers do not accept distribution of an input signal to several outputs An input signal can only be routed to one single output The Firmware of our RS 422 routers takes care of these limitations If an input Source is already connected to a particular output Destination any connection of this input to another output will disconnect the previous connection The router will in this case send the following message for the disconnected output Output connected to input 12

16. unused addresses 7 3 RS232 The RS 232 port is used for external control of Network units The RS 232 port allows the customer to control the equipment via Miranda s 1 Control PC program or self defined customized solutions Connector for the RS 232 port is a DS9 female Pin 2 Tx Pin 3 Rx Pin 5 GND A standard DCE Data Communication Equipment cable can be used for connection between PC and Network equipment The connection between the connectors is made one to one Data rate is 19200 baud sec 8 data bit 1 stop bit no parity 7 4 MIDI The MIDI bus is used for interconnection between several Network units Up to 50 routers and or control panels can be linked together to form a routing system with many operational features The MIDI bus utilises a 5 mA current loop with opto coupled ports Standard connector is a 5pin DIN Standard MIDI cables can be used to interconnect several Network units Data rate is 31 25 kbit sec 1 start bit 8 data bit no parity 1 stop bit Logical 0 current ON 7 5 Commands 7 5 1 Audio crosspoint set Only for use with Audio routers Command for setting of crosspoints 1001nnnn Okkk kkkk Ovvv vvvv nnnn is the matrix address from 0 up to 15 kkk kkkk is the output which shall be controlled kkk kkkk output number 0 output 1 127 output 128 vvv vyvv is the input which shall be connected to the chosen output vvv Vvvv input number Technical specifications ar
